Skip to content

Commit 027a1ea

Browse files
committed
Skip tier 2 and tier 3 platforms for now
As stated in #16, it is taking 3 months to build documentation for all platforms. I will enable them for new releases when initial build finishes.
1 parent c58bf1d commit 027a1ea

File tree

1 file changed

+30
-28
lines changed

1 file changed

+30
-28
lines changed

src/docbuilder/chroot_builder.rs

Lines changed: 30 additions & 28 deletions
Original file line numberDiff line numberDiff line change
@@ -135,42 +135,44 @@ impl DocBuilder {
135135

136136
/// Builds documentation of crate for every target and returns Vec of successfully targets
137137
fn build_package_for_all_targets(&self, package: &Package) -> Vec<String> {
138-
let targets = ["aarch64-apple-ios",
139-
"aarch64-linux-android",
140-
"aarch64-unknown-linux-gnu",
141-
"arm-linux-androideabi",
142-
"arm-unknown-linux-gnueabi",
143-
"arm-unknown-linux-gnueabihf",
144-
"armv7-apple-ios",
145-
"armv7-linux-androideabi",
146-
"armv7-unknown-linux-gnueabihf",
147-
"armv7s-apple-ios",
148-
"i386-apple-ios",
149-
"i586-pc-windows-msvc",
150-
"i586-unknown-linux-gnu",
138+
// Temporary skip tier 2 and tier 3 platforms
139+
let targets = [// "aarch64-apple-ios",
140+
// "aarch64-linux-android",
141+
// "aarch64-unknown-linux-gnu",
142+
// "arm-linux-androideabi",
143+
// "arm-unknown-linux-gnueabi",
144+
// "arm-unknown-linux-gnueabihf",
145+
// "armv7-apple-ios",
146+
// "armv7-linux-androideabi",
147+
// "armv7-unknown-linux-gnueabihf",
148+
// "armv7s-apple-ios",
149+
// "i386-apple-ios",
150+
// "i586-pc-windows-msvc",
151+
// "i586-unknown-linux-gnu",
151152
"i686-apple-darwin",
152-
"i686-linux-android",
153+
// "i686-linux-android",
153154
"i686-pc-windows-gnu",
154155
"i686-pc-windows-msvc",
155-
"i686-unknown-freebsd",
156+
// "i686-unknown-freebsd",
156157
"i686-unknown-linux-gnu",
157-
"i686-unknown-linux-musl",
158-
"mips-unknown-linux-gnu",
159-
"mips-unknown-linux-musl",
160-
"mipsel-unknown-linux-gnu",
161-
"mipsel-unknown-linux-musl",
162-
"powerpc-unknown-linux-gnu",
163-
"powerpc64-unknown-linux-gnu",
164-
"powerpc64le-unknown-linux-gnu",
158+
// "i686-unknown-linux-musl",
159+
// "mips-unknown-linux-gnu",
160+
// "mips-unknown-linux-musl",
161+
// "mipsel-unknown-linux-gnu",
162+
// "mipsel-unknown-linux-musl",
163+
// "powerpc-unknown-linux-gnu",
164+
// "powerpc64-unknown-linux-gnu",
165+
// "powerpc64le-unknown-linux-gnu",
165166
"x86_64-apple-darwin",
166-
"x86_64-apple-ios",
167+
// "x86_64-apple-ios",
167168
"x86_64-pc-windows-gnu",
168169
"x86_64-pc-windows-msvc",
169-
"x86_64-rumprun-netbsd",
170-
"x86_64-unknown-freebsd",
170+
// "x86_64-rumprun-netbsd",
171+
// "x86_64-unknown-freebsd",
171172
"x86_64-unknown-linux-gnu",
172-
"x86_64-unknown-linux-musl",
173-
"x86_64-unknown-netbsd"];
173+
// "x86_64-unknown-linux-musl",
174+
// "x86_64-unknown-netbsd",
175+
];
174176

175177
let mut successfuly_targets = Vec::new();
176178

0 commit comments

Comments
 (0)